Which gas is used for welding?
ANitrogen
BArgon
CAcetylene
DOxygen
Explanation
• Acetylene is a hydrocarbon used in oxy-acetylene welding due to its high combustion temperature.
• When combined with oxygen, it creates a flame hot enough to melt most metals.
• It is a common tool in manufacturing and construction.
